Realizing that most of us have been riding the Iomega train, has anyone been watching The Panda Project? The company develops, markets and licenses computer and semiconductor technology. Its principal product is the Archistrat 4s server, a desktop computer with 256-bit chip capacity and which is adaptable to the latest hardware and software as the technology changes. 1996 EPS estimated at 1.50. This stock appears to be breaking out. Anyone agree? | ||||||||||||||
